“Friendly staff but dirty room”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 3 January 2012
1
person found this review helpful

My family stayed at this hotel for a NYE wedding. The front desk staff was very friendly and check in was easy. The hotel was full between the wedding guests, the holiday weekend and local oil and gas men looking for rooms. We live locally but decided to stay the night to avoid driving on NYE.

The hotel has been open for ever but has undergone several name / ownership changes in recent years. We received a room with two small full size beds and it came to about $122 for the night.

The room appeared clean at first except for the carpet but when my young child dropped a toy and it rolled under the edge of the bedspread, we found a lifesaver and fork laying there so obviously the sweeper had not been run in quite some time! The room was incredibly hot and the AC did not seem to be working, nor did the window open - it was miserable to sleep in. The walls were very thin and we could here lots of conversations and people moving about all night and we were up on the 4th floor. The TV was small and older and the shower leaked into the tub so the water pressure was poor. The breakfast consisted of some fruit, packaged sweet rolls, coffee and orange juice.

Overall for the price and the size of this small town we were dissapointed with our stay. Wheeling has several newer (Springhill) or recently updated (Hampton) hotels so if you are coming to visit, we recommend those over the McClure.

“A Good Bet for Wheeling”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 10 November 2011

Don’t know how often you’re likely to find yourself in Wheeling, West Virginia. It’s an interesting city with fascinating architecture and a great old bridge — and seemingly not enough people to fill it up. We stayed at the McLure House Hotel on Market Street which also seems to go by the moniker, the Clarion.

It’s a sturdy place, like the city, that struggles a little to keep up — but the rooms were clean and comfortable and the folks there very pleasant and helpful. Good rates, too. Located right in the middle of the city. Had a wonderful dinner at the Metropolitan Citi Grill, a place that could earn top stars in any city at all.

“Has seen better days. We will not be back.”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 11 August 2011

We attended a wedding and our family had three rooms. The problems we encounted were numerous. First, the a/c either ran all the time (freezing) or did not run (hot). The wall were thin and the noise of slamming doors and running water was very loud. We asked for queen beds and all three rooms had what looked like small full beds. The wall paper was coming off at the seams and they had used staples to hold them down. The toliet was louder than an airlane flush. The carpet was in dire need of cleaning, The TV was an old CRT and the picture was very poor. The breakfast consisted of some fruit, packaged sweet rolls, coffee and orange juice. The only nice thing about the Mclure was the entrance and it was close to the wedding receiption. Since the hotel said they were full we could not request another room.
I noticed that most of the good reviews were from previous years. I would not recommend staying at this Hotel.

“Disgusting.”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 29 July 2011

Yellow stains on the sheets, trash unemptied, no toilet paper, floor unvacuumed, and the ice machine was broken. We asked for a new set of sheets and came back to the room 3 hours later to find they had still not been changed. Called again and waited 30 minutes, never heard from any staff members. Service was terrible, we were completely ignored and our room had not been cleaned whatsoever since previous guests.

“Great Hotel”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 13 July 2010

Don't listen to the other reviews. This hotel is wonderful. My room was very large with two beds and beautiful furnishings. Everything was impecably clean and tasteful. The bathroom was so large I was surprised...you could actually move and and get ready with out walking into the main room. I couldn't have been happier. There was a large window that partialy opened for getting that fresh morning air. No the view wasn't great but I had a mirrored building in view that reflected the golden sunset and sunrise which I loved...Also the shower had great water preasure that felt good after long hot days..
And if that wasn't enough my car was in a covered garage which kept the sun from beating on it. The breakfast in the lobby was a great added touch. The staff was incredable with giving directions...Chris helped me find North Wheeling and the entire staff was as nice and helpful as you could want. I was treated and felt like I was in a 4 star hotel. I love Wheeling the people, architechture, history and walking for hours seeing all the history and people. Most people I talked to were so proud of the city they lived in and were so ready to tell you all about the city and history. Stayng at the McClure allowed me great access for walking or driving anywhere in the area. I want to thank the staff of the McClure for helping me have a great vacation.
